Experiences with Cambridgeshire CMHT by CuriousNewt_ in cambridge

[–]FellowEnt 1 point2 points  (0 children)

My experience was gp gave me a self referral leaflet, I was on waiting list for Talking Therapies for 6 weeks or so. Ended up on a wednesday mid morning slot for Zoom call with therapist younger than me. I already suffered anxiety with having to take time away from work for this. The sessions were very low level, generally self directed despite me being upgraded to more severe condition. The sessions concluded with not much more benefit than counselling. I had to drive a lot of the depth and ask for more and more information. The therapist pulled out a lot of textbook worksheets to look at. It felt like GCSE practice revision rather than professional care.

I withheld any talk of suicidal thoughts as that complicates the level of care and at that point I just needed something to get moving in the system.

I know what my issues are and I understand the root of them. It was valuable to be diagnosed by a professional with depression and anxiety.

I was promised a follow-up session but they never made contact with me again. It's been about 3 years since.

I'm now in a slightly better financial position and I'll go private next time.

King Gizzard on MiniDisc? by BeeTwoThousand in KGATLW

[–]FellowEnt 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Animal collective released their Feels anniversary edition on mini disc because they used mini disc to record and play back field recordings for their live performances. Its quite a versatile and lightweight recording medium.
